Fiercely competitive bidding in an auction for a flying lesson in a flight simulator at RAF Linton-on-Ouse, raised a soaraway £3,500 for the Press Guardian Angels appeal.
Dozens of business people at the awards vied for the chance to take a simulated low-level jet flight over the Lake District.
Successful bidder was Paul Nolan, non executive director of Charterhouse recruitment company, of York and Leeds.
"It has always been my lifetime ambition," he said.
Another £1,000 was raised for the appeal through cash donations on the night.
